The Winchester is a brass candelabra chandelier with a candle-effect design — the arms terminate in upright candle-tube sockets rather than shades, so the bare brass metalwork and the flame-tip bulbs are the full visual statement. Cast in brass throughout, the arms curve outward from the central column in the classical chandelier form, the warm metal finish reading as period-appropriate and richly decorative. With no shades or diffusers, the fixture relies entirely on the interplay of brass and candle-effect bulbs for its character.

Four configurations scale from a compact 3-head at ∅ 45 cm to a grand 10-head at ∅ 100 cm, all sharing the same 50 cm hanging chain. As head count and diameter increase, the fixture moves from an intimate accent to a full architectural statement suited to grand foyers and formal dining rooms.

Bulbs are not included. Each arm uses one E12 (US) or E14 (international) candelabra socket. For a candle-effect chandelier, the bulb choice defines the result: a flame-tip LED E12/E14 candelabra bulb at 2200–2700K amber warm white is the most period-authentic option — the tapered flame-tip shape reads as a real candle above each brass candle tube. Clear-glass filament bulbs at 2200K amber are an excellent alternative, particularly when dimmed. Avoid frosted or opal bulbs which conceal the candle-effect form.

Which configuration suits my space? +

Match the diameter to the space: the 3-head (∅ 45 cm) suits bedrooms, entryways, and small dining tables up to 100 cm. The 6-head (∅ 65 cm) is the most versatile for standard dining rooms and living rooms — it covers a 140–160 cm dining table well. The 8-head (∅ 85 cm) suits grand dining rooms and larger tables (180–200 cm). The 10-head (∅ 100 cm) is the statement version — suited to grand foyers, double-height spaces, and the largest formal rooms. A general rule: the chandelier diameter should be roughly half to two-thirds the width of the table below it.

What is a “candle effect” chandelier? +

A candle-effect chandelier has upright candle-tube sockets at the end of each arm, designed to hold flame-tip bulbs that mimic real candles — there are no shades or glass diffusers. This is the most traditional chandelier form, referencing the original candle chandeliers these fixtures evolved from. The visual effect depends heavily on the bulb: a flame-tip amber LED completes the candle illusion, while a plain bulb undermines it. For the most authentic result, always use flame-tip candelabra bulbs with this fixture.

What bulb gives the best candle effect? +

A flame-tip E12/E14 LED candelabra bulb at 2200–2700K amber warm white. The tapered flame-shaped tip sits above each brass candle tube exactly as a real taper candle would, and the amber colour temperature produces a warmth closest to candlelight. Clear-glass filament bulbs (visible spiral filament, amber glass) are the second-best option — the visible filament adds animation at low brightness. Avoid frosted, opal, or globe-shaped bulbs, which conceal the candle-tip form and undermine the candle effect entirely.

Is it dimmable? +

Yes, when fitted with dimmable E12/E14 LED candelabra bulbs and a compatible TRIAC wall dimmer switch (both sold separately). Specify “dimmable” when purchasing bulbs and confirm your dimmer is rated for the total LED wattage across all arms. For a candle-effect chandelier, dimming to 20–40% produces the most authentic candlelit result — at low brightness the warm-amber flame-tip bulbs produce a genuinely intimate quality of light, and the brass arms catch the reduced output as a series of warm highlights.

Measuring for Pendant Lighting

When installing pendants and chandeliers, it’s important to consider how you want your fixtures to hang in relation to the other furnishings in your space. Read on for our recommendations on how to hang the perfect light.

Kitchen

Aim for 30–36″ from the bottom of your fixture’s shade to the top of your island or countertop. Space multiple pendants 26–30″ apart. For a sense of proportion and balance, allow 12″ from the outermost fixture to the edge of your counter.

Dining Room

For optimal lighting and visibility, the bottom of your pendant should sit 30″ from the surface of your dining table. To scale your fixture, take the length and width of the room in feet, then convert that to inches. For a 10′ by 14′ room, the chandelier should be about 24″ wide.

Bedroom

If you’re hanging a pendant above a nightstand, allow for at least 30″ between the bottom of the shade and your nightstand’s surface. To keep the look balanced, center your pendant over your nightstand.
